The Benefit of a Second Rise in Bread Baking, here is Bread dough typically goes through two rising sessions before it is ready to go into the oven. The yeast in the dough breaks down sugars to create carbon dioxide to cause the bread to rise. After the initial rising period, the dough is punched down and shaped into loaves for the second rise, which affects how the bread looks and tastes after baking.
